Prep and Cook Time
- Readiness: 10 minutes
- Cooking: 15 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
Yield
- Serves 4 generous servings
difficulty Level
- Easy - perfect for all skill levels
Ingredients
- 4 cups whole milk (for creamier texture, use 2 cups whole milk + 2 cups heavy cream)
- 1/2 cup high-quality unsweetened cocoa powder, sifted
- 1/3 cup granulated sugar (adjust to taste)
- 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ips or chopped dark chocolate (60-70% cocoa)
- 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
- 8 large marshmallows (preferably jumbo-size)
- Pinch of sea salt
- Optional garnish: crushed graham crackers, caramel drizzle, or a dusting of cinnamon
Instructions
- Prepare Your Marshmallows: Using a long skewer or roasting fork, carefully toast the marshmallows over a low flame – a gas stove, grill, or even a candle flame works well. Rotate slowly to achieve an even, golden-brown crust with a slight smoky aroma.Watch closely to avoid charring completely; the goal is a delicate caramelized exterior with gooey soft centers.
- Warm the Milk Base: In a medium saucepan over medium heat, combine whole milk, cocoa powder, sugar, and sea salt. Whisk continuously until the sugar dissolves and the cocoa melds evenly with the milk, about 4-5 minutes.
- Melt the Chocolate: Lower the heat and add the semi-sweet chocolate chips. Stir gently until fully melted, creating a rich, velvety liquid. Remove from heat and whisk in the vanilla extract.
- Combine and Heat Through: Return the pan to very low heat to keep the chocolate warm but avoid boiling, wich can separate the milk fats. Keep whisking gently for 2-3 minutes to achieve a smooth, luxurious texture.
- Assemble the Drink: Pour the hot chocolate into heatproof mugs. Top each cup with two toasted marshmallows, gently pressing one into the surface to start melting, and nestle the other on top for a photogenic, puffy crown.
- Optional Garnishing: Sprinkle with crushed graham crackers for a s’mores twist, drizzle caramel sauce, or dust with a hint of cinnamon for extra warmth and spice complexity.
Tips for Success
- For the ultimate creaminess, swap half the milk for heavy cream or coconut milk for a dairy-free rich option.
- Toasting marshmallows indoors: A kitchen torch or oven broiler works perfectly if you lack an open flame.
- Chocolate quality matters: Use good-quality chocolate for that deep cocoa flavor. Avoid powders with fillers or low cocoa content.
- If your hot chocolate becomes grainy, gently reheat off the flame and whisk vigorously or use an immersion blender for a super smooth finish.
- Make-ahead tip: Prepare the hot chocolate base ahead, cool and refrigerate it, then gently reheat when ready. Toast fresh marshmallows just before serving to preserve their texture.

Q1: What makes toasted marshmallow hot chocolate so irresistibly cozy?
A1: It’s the perfect marriage of creamy, rich chocolate with the nostalgic flavor of lightly charred marshmallows. The toasty, caramelized sugars add a smoky sweetness that elevates traditional hot chocolate into a warm hug in a mug.
Q2: Can I use different types of chocolate for this recipe?
A2: Absolutely! Whether you prefer dark chocolate for a deep, bittersweet bite, milk chocolate for a creamier swirl, or even white chocolate for a luxuriously sweet twist, each brings a unique dimension to your hot cocoa base.
Q3: How do I toast marshmallows safely at home?
A3: You can toast marshmallows over the stove flame with a skewer or use a culinary torch for precision browning.If neither is available, broiling them in your oven on a baking sheet for a minute or two will create that signature toasted effect-just watch closely to avoid burning!
Q4: What’s the best way to make the hot chocolate rich and creamy?
A4: Start by warming whole milk or a creamy choice like oat milk; then melt your chocolate slowly to maintain smoothness. Adding a touch of heavy cream or coconut milk can also boost the richness, turning every sip into velvet.
Q5: Can I add spices or other flavors to customize my toasted marshmallow hot chocolate?
A5: Definitely! A pinch of cinnamon, a dash of vanilla extract, or even a hint of chili powder can add warmth and complexity.Nutmeg and cardamom offer a cozy spice twist, perfect for those who crave a little extra flair.
Q6: How do I prevent the marshmallows from melting too quickly in the hot chocolate?
A6: Toast your marshmallows just before serving and place them on top gently. Using larger marshmallows or stacking a few provides a delightful texture contrast, where the toasted exterior remains slightly crispy while the inside melts into gooey goodness.
Q7: What’s the ideal mug for enjoying toasted marshmallow hot chocolate?
A7: Go for a wide-rimmed ceramic mug that helps the warm aroma rise, inviting you to savor every sip. Thick walls keep your drink hotter longer-a must for slow, cozy moments.
Q8: Are there dairy-free options that still keep the drink creamy and luscious?
A8: Yes! Almond milk,oat milk,and coconut milk are fantastic choices.
